Output ec041cb640b9fbcfef68fbdcffc575fc75ba81543007263ca3a930ea2295de03:105

value
28366
script pubkey
OP_0 OP_PUSHBYTES_20 69e9e5fc39d006b967ce7d6094177efd43382514
address
bc1qd857tlpe6qrtje7w04sfg9m7l4pnsfg5kshcak
transaction
ec041cb640b9fbcfef68fbdcffc575fc75ba81543007263ca3a930ea2295de03
confirmations
33129
spent
true